Of course, I expected decent gelato at the very least, but what I didn't expect was all sorts of flavours even exotic ones! Chocolate chili, anyone? (Full bodied chocolate with a slight kick from the chili) Papaya-Passion Fruit (heavy on the passion fruit, hardly tasted the papaya). Chocoholics are well taken cared off, because one fridge is just for chocolate flavours! My brothers and I love the Veronese, which is the gelato version of Ferrero. I was so hooked at during my week or so in Cebu I ate it everyday and towards the end of my trip I had their gelato three times a day. 







I later found out there's a lone branch here in Manila (Greenbelt 5) so whenever I'm in Greenbelt, I make sure I'd stop by this shop.
